A new serious diplomatic incident is brewing in the relations between Russia and Sweden. The Ministry of Foreign Affairs of the Russian Federation has decided to summon the Swedish Ambassador to Moscow, Kristina Johannesson. The reason for such a sharp reaction was the attack on the Russian embassy in Stockholm, which took place in the early hours of July 2.

Details of the night provocation

According to information provided by the Russian diplomatic department, two unmanned aerial vehicles launched an attack on the territory of the diplomatic mission. The incident, according to the Russian Ambassador to Sweden, Sergey Belyaev, was planned as a simulation of a real attack with the aim of intimidating staff.

The actions of the drones were clearly divided: the first device dropped a container of red paint onto the embassy grounds, creating the effect of an attack with chemical or biological weapons. The second drone, to which a simulated improvised explosive device was attached, crashed in the immediate vicinity of the building. The Russian side qualifies these actions as an attempt to intimidate diplomats.

Moscow's reaction and claims against Stockholm

Moscow has already reacted to the incident by sending an official protest to the Swedish Ministry of Foreign Affairs. The Russian department places full responsibility for the security of diplomatic missions on the host country. Reference is made to the 1961 Vienna Convention on Diplomatic Relations, which obliges the receiving state to guarantee the inviolability of the premises of the mission.

Official representative of the Russian MFA Maria Zakharova confirmed that the summoning of the Swedish ambassador is a direct consequence of this incident. The department emphasizes that such actions in the Swedish capital, according to their data, have become regular. Russian diplomats note that over the last two years, there have already been dozens of such provocations, but the results of the investigations have not been made public.

Consequences for bilateral relations

Summoning an ambassador is one of the harshest tools of diplomatic pressure. This action signals that Moscow considers Stockholm's actions unacceptable and in violation of international norms. The drone incident, which Russian diplomats call a "simulated attack," could become a reason for further cooling of relations between the two countries if the Swedish side does not provide convincing explanations and ensure the security of the diplomatic mission in the future.
